About The Position

The Restaurant Sommelier is responsible for managing the wine program, including issuing, opening, and serving wine and champagne. This role involves interacting with guests to answer questions about wine origins, vintages, and styles, as well as maintaining the wine list and MICROS system. The Sommelier will also be tasked with pairing wines with menu items, attending wine tastings, developing vendor relationships, and requesting new wines and products. Additionally, they will create and update wine lists, design and implement wine promotions, monitor and replenish wine cellar inventory, and train staff on wine knowledge. The position also includes conducting vintage and BIN number checks, staff wine tastings, and ensuring the security of alcoholic beverages and storage areas, all while adhering to responsible alcohol service laws and maintaining accurate records.
